Using Omada Controller 4.1.5, the auto backup feature is failing to execute.

 

My logs state:

[Failed]Auto Backup failed to execute with generating file AutoBackup failed because autobackup schedule time was expired.

 

I thought it might have been due to importing my backup from 3.2.10 so I disabled Auto Backups and re-enabled them but it continues to fail.  Here are my settings:

Hyundai wrote

Please patch asap.

 

Ehm, I'm not from TP-Link, I can't patch anything.

 

To make auto-backup working I suggest the work-around to set the Controller's timezone to UTC (Universal Time Coordinated) and only the Site's timezone to whatever you have +1 hour (to get DST) until TP-Link has fixed the bug.
